Skanska gets gold for two of its Polish office buildings

by Property Forum
Building B at the Warsaw Spark complex and Generation Park Z are the next Skanska office buildings which have received the WELL Core & Shell certificate at the Gold level from the International WELL Building Institute (IWBI). This is the fourth and fifth Skanska project certified in Central and Eastern Europe.

Skanska starts construction of Warsaw office complex

by Property Forum
A location between two metro stations - Rondo ONZ and Rondo Daszyńskiego, characteristic Xs in the architecture of the ground floor. These are just some of the distinguishing features of the new Skanska project in Warsaw. Studio, the newest Skanska office complex, the construction of which starts on Prosta Street, will provide a total lease area of approx. 43,000 sqm GLA. This is yet another project of the Swedish developer in the business district in Warsaw.

Skanska begins next phase of Centrum Południe in Wrocław

by Property Forum
Over 21,000 sqm of office space located on 13 floors, terraces for tenants and a basketball court – this will be the second phase of the Centrum Południe office complex currently being developed by Skanska. Like the existing buildings, the new phase will apply for numerous certificates, including the WELL Core&Shell.

Romanian H1 property deals close to €300 million

by Property Forum
Transactions in Romania’s commercial real estate market amounted to €298 million in the first half of the year, down 23% compared to the same period of 2020, according to a report by real estate consultancy Cushman & Wakefield Echinox.

Skanska completes €97 million sale of Campus 6 in Bucharest

by Property Forum
Real estate group Skanska says it fully completed the sale of office buildings Campus 6.2 and 6.3 within Campus 6, the complex developed in western Bucharest, in its biggest local deal valued at €97 million.

Skanska completes Phase D of Nowy Rynek complex in Poznań

by Property Forum
Another building of the Nowy Rynek complex in Poznan, developed by Skanska, has received its occupancy permit. Phase D provides approx. 39,000 sqm of office space and will be the first investment in the region to apply for the WELL Core&Shell certificate. It is also the only place in Poznan with a pavement made of green concrete that cleans the air.

The third High5ive building topped out and 100% leased

by Property Forum
A symbolic topping out was hung on the top floor of the third stage of the High5ive complex by Skanska in Kraków. This means that the main construction work has been completed and the building has reached its target height. Already at this stage of construction, the office section of the building has been completely leased out. With the commissioning, which is scheduled for the first quarter of 2022, Krakow will gain over 11,000 sqm of sustainable and modern office space. This is the first Skanska project in the capital of Lesser Poland, which will apply for the prestigious WELL Core&Shell certificate.

Skanska launches new office project in Poznań

by Property Forum
The Swedish developer launches the construction of another building in the Nowy Rynek complex in Poznań which is going to consist of approx. 28,500 sqm of office space. It will apply for a WELL Core&Shell certificate. The commissioning is scheduled for Q2 2023.
